Tony Rizzo Lashes Out Against Browns as Fans Frustrated with HC Hiring
It's been over 20 days since the Cleveland Browns fired Kevin Stefanski, yet there's no replacement. And this time, Tony Rizzo bashed the team for one fixation that he thinks has delayed the process.
"Their infatuation with analytics, where has it gotten them? YOU S***! YOU S***! Do you need me to tell you this? Or can you just look at your record and your roster? YOU S***! The analytics got you one of the worst trades of all time. "
Rizzo referred to the Browns' head coach evaluation process. According to NFL Network insider Tom Pelissero, the candidates have to answer obligatory introductory questionnaires, personality tests, and also submit a multi-part essay. This criteria frustrated as the every candidate kept dropping out of the race.
Rizzo added, "The analytics have produced the worst coaching candidates I've ever seen in Hue Jackson and Freddie Kitchens, and you're going back at it? What is wrong with these people?"
He was referring to the Browns' two previous head coaches who came before Kevin Stefanski. Hue Jackson holds the second-worst coaching record at the team. Between 2016 and 2018, he managed just 3 wins in 40 games. And Freddie Kitchens wasn't great either. He had 6 wins in 16 games in 2019.
The Browns' approach isn't just taking up time, it's letting strong candidates out of their reach. Just a few weeks ago, we talked about the legendary John Harbaugh potentially joining the team. And since then, it has just been one coach after another falling out of the race.
Cleveland needs a decision soon. The Ravens, Giants, Dolphins and Falcons have all found their new leaders. Mike McDaniel took up an offensive coordinator job. And now, one of their biggest prospects is out as well.
Grant Udinski Pulls Out of Browns Coaching Race
After a stellar job giving the Jaguars' offense a new start, Grant Udinski was looking for a head coaching position. He was a leading candidate at the Browns and the Bills.
According to reports, Udinski will be getting a new deal in Jacksonville and has pulled out of the Browns head coach race. However, he is still in contention for the Bills job.
